Subject: Flagwright cut-over — done!

Hey all, quick recap for folks who just joined: we finished moving every service off the old toggle library onto Flagwright last night. Rollouts are now percentage-based, and kill switches propagate in under ten seconds. Marisol double-checked the audit trail and everything lines up. If a flag misbehaves, flip it in the dashboard first, ask questions later. The current production settings are as follows:

deployment values, kahof-yadug:
[gorys]
team = silael
access_code = ac_00d620
owner = istox.oliys
host = gorys.torvastack.example
port = 9000
peer = holmir.merlaqsoft.example
salt = 9fdae78a
pin = 2358

- [ ] Confirm user-supplied formulas in Gridforge execute only inside the Cellbox sandbox: no filesystem access, no network calls, 50ms CPU cap per evaluation. Fuzz results from the Marrow Lake test cluster should show zero escapes across the full corpus. The trace token for the reviewed sandbox build follows below.

session token of taduf-tahog = htk4_91a1

# Reseller Programme — Managers Only

Quick update for the board: the Larkspur reseller programme is live in three regions. Margins sit at 22%, onboarding takes about two weeks, and Trevane Distribution signed as anchor partner. We're capping partner count at fifteen this year. The reasoning behind that cap is set out just below.

internal memo for yawip-kajef: Silirox Partners plans to raise the Kelox list price by 30 percent in December.

## Changelog — v4.2.1

Rotated the plugin signing key for Validex following our scheduled quarterly rotation. All first-party validator plugins have been re-signed; third-party authors were notified last week. Support: customers on v4.1 or older may see load warnings until they update. The new key, which all plugins must now verify against, is below.

deploy key for bawig-tajop: bky9_PQ3GVoQw1